Abstract
The Air Force Material Command Advanced Robotics Technology Insertion Program (ARTIP) was formally initiated in August 1992. The ARTIP Program Action Directive (PAD) codifies the mission and responsibilities that the AFMC Robotics and Automation Center of Excellence (RACE) has been actively pursuing since October 1991. AFMC RACE is a command wide focal point, an organic source of expertise to assist the logistic and product centers in improving process productivity through the judicious insertion of robotics and automation technologies. This paper provides an overview of the ARTIP PAD and an update on major RACE activities in support of those objectives.
